Cheesy Garlic Chicken Wraps Recipe

If you’re look­ing for a quick, fla­vor­ful, and sat­is­fy­ing meal, look no fur­ther than these Cheesy Gar­lic Chick­en Wraps. This recipe com­bines ten­der, sea­soned chick­en, melt­ed cheese, and a creamy gar­lic sauce all wrapped in a warm tor­tilla. It’s a sim­ple yet irre­sistible dish that will become a sta­ple in your kitchen, per­fect for lunch or din­ner. With just a few ingre­di­ents and min­i­mal prepa­ra­tion, you can enjoy a deli­cious home­made wrap in no time.

The secret to these Cheesy Gar­lic Chick­en Wraps lies in the bal­ance of fla­vors. The chick­en is sea­soned with gar­lic pow­der, onion pow­der, and oregano, then cooked until gold­en and juicy. The gar­lic ranch dress­ing adds a creamy, tangy kick that pairs per­fect­ly with the melty moz­zarel­la cheese. For an added crunch and fresh­ness, you can add spinach or oth­er veg­gies. This wrap is high­ly cus­tomiz­able, so feel free to adjust the ingre­di­ents to suit your taste.

Cook­ing these wraps is easy and quick. Sim­ply cook the chick­en, pre­pare the creamy gar­lic sauce, and assem­ble every­thing on a tor­tilla. After grilling the wraps to gold­en per­fec­tion, you’ll have a meal that’s both sat­is­fy­ing and deli­cious. Ingredients:

  • 2 bone­less, skin­less chick­en breasts (or thighs, if pre­ferred)
  • 4 large flour tor­tillas
  • 1 cup shred­ded moz­zarel­la cheese (or a cheese blend of your choice)
  • 2 table­spoons olive oil (for cook­ing)
  • 3 cloves gar­lic, minced
  • 1/2 cup ranch dress­ing (or creamy gar­lic dress­ing)
  • 1 tea­spoon dried oregano
  • 1 tea­spoon gar­lic pow­der
  • 1 tea­spoon onion pow­der
  • Salt and pep­per to taste
  • 1/2 cup fresh spinach (option­al)
  • 1/4 cup chopped fresh pars­ley (for gar­nish)
  • 1 table­spoon but­ter (for grilling the wraps)

Instructions:

  1. Pre­pare the Chick­en:
    • Sea­son the chick­en breasts with salt, pep­per, gar­lic pow­der, onion pow­der, and dried oregano on both sides.
    • Heat olive oil in a skil­let over medi­um-high heat. Cook the chick­en breasts for about 5–7 min­utes per side, or until ful­ly cooked and gold­en brown. Remove from the skil­let and let rest for a few min­utes before slic­ing into strips.
  2. Pre­pare the Gar­lic Sauce:
    • In a small bowl, mix the minced gar­lic with the ranch dress­ing to cre­ate a creamy gar­lic sauce.
  3. Assem­ble the Wraps:
    • Lay the flour tor­tillas flat on a clean sur­face. Spread a gen­er­ous amount of the gar­lic ranch sauce in the cen­ter of each tor­tilla.
    • Add a few slices of the cooked chick­en on top of the sauce, fol­lowed by a hand­ful of shred­ded moz­zarel­la cheese. If using spinach, add a few leaves on top for extra fla­vor and crunch.
  4. Grill the Wraps:
    • Heat a table­spoon of but­ter in a large skil­let or grill pan over medi­um heat. Place each wrap in the pan and grill for about 2–3 min­utes on each side until the tor­tillas are gold­en brown and crispy, and the cheese is melt­ed inside.
  5. Serve:
    • Once grilled, remove the wraps from the skil­let and let them cool slight­ly. Slice the wraps in half, sprin­kle with chopped pars­ley, and serve imme­di­ate­ly. Enjoy!

Tips:

  • Feel free to add oth­er veg­gies like bell pep­pers, onions, or toma­toes to enhance the fla­vor.
  • If you pre­fer a health­i­er ver­sion, you can use whole wheat tor­tillas or a lighter dress­ing.
